Technique Tip for This Recipe
To achieve an even golden brown crust, make sure to preheat your skillet properly before placing the bread on it. This ensures that the butter melts evenly and the bread toasts uniformly. Additionally, using a lid while cooking can help the cheese melt faster and more thoroughly.

How to Store / Freeze This Recipe
- Allow the hot ham and cheese sandwiches to cool completely before storing. This prevents condensation, which can make the bread soggy.
- Wrap each sandwich individually in aluminum foil or plastic wrap. This helps to maintain freshness and prevents the sandwiches from sticking together.
- Place the wrapped sandwiches in an airtight container or a zip-top freezer bag. If using a freezer bag, remove as much air as possible before sealing to prevent freezer burn.
- Label the container or bag with the date. This helps you keep track of how long the sandwiches have been stored.
- Store the sandwiches in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. For longer storage, place them in the freezer where they can be kept for up to 2 months.
- To reheat refrigerated sandwiches,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Place the sandwiches on a baking sheet and heat for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the sandwiches are heated through.
- For frozen sandwiches, allow them to th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ating. Alternatively, you can reheat directly from frozen by increasing the oven time to 20-25 minutes.
- If you prefer a quicker method, you can reheat the sandwiches in a microwave. Unwrap the sandwich and place it on a microwave-safe plate. Heat on high for 1-2 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the sandwich is hot. Be cautious, as microwaving can sometimes make the bread a bit chewy.
- For an extra crispy texture, consider reheating the sandwiches in a toaster oven or on a skillet over medium heat. This will help to restore the golden brown crust.
How to Reheat Leftovers
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Wrap the sandwiches in aluminum foil to prevent them from drying out. Place them on a baking sheet and heat for about 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the ham is heated through.
Use a skillet or griddle over medium heat. Place the sandwiches in the skillet and cover with a lid to help the cheese melt evenly. Heat for 3-4 minutes on each side, or until the bread is crispy and the cheese is gooey.
For a quick fix, use a microwave. Place the sandwiches on a microwave-safe plate and cover with a damp paper towel to keep them from drying out. Heat on medium power for 1-2 minutes, checking halfway through to ensure even heating.
If you have an air fryer, preheat it to 350°F (175°C). Place the sandwiches in the basket and heat for 3-5 minutes, or until the bread is crispy and the cheese is melted.

Hot Ham and Cheese Recipe
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 8 slices Bread
- 8 slices Ham
- 4 slices Cheese
- 2 tablespoon Butter
Instructions
- 1. Heat a skillet over medium heat.
- 2. Butter one side of each slice of bread.
- 3. Place 4 slices of bread, buttered side down, on the skillet.
- 4. Add a slice of cheese and 2 slices of ham on each piece of bread.
- 5. Top with the remaining slices of bread, buttered side up.
- 6. Cook until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ted, about 3-4 minutes per side.
